What will happen to water molecules when electricity is passed through water during electrolysis?

During electrolysis of water, the water molecules will dissociate into their constituent elements: hydrogen and oxygen. This occurs due to the electrical current breaking the bonds within water molecules, leading to the release of hydrogen gas at the cathode and oxygen gas at the anode.


What are materials that don't transfer electrical current?

Materials that do not transfer electrical current are called insulators. Common examples include rubber, glass, plastic, and wood. These materials have high resistance to the flow of electrical current due to their atomic structure.


The ability of an object to transfer electric current?

The ability of an object to transfer electric current is determined by its electrical conductivity. Materials with high electrical conductivity, such as metals, allow electric current to flow easily through them, while insulating materials have low electrical conductivity and inhibit the flow of current. Conductors like copper and silver are widely used for their high electrical conductivity.

What does the process of electrolysis of water mean?

The process of electrolysis of water involves passing an electric current through water to separate it into its two components, hydrogen and oxygen. This is done by using electrodes to facilitate the decomposition of water molecules into hydrogen gas at the cathode and oxygen gas at the anode.
